x close
FIND A DOCTOR
Careers at DDH

Careers at DDH

Create a free DDH CAREERS candidate’s account and start applying to your dream job!


• Easy creation and update of your online profile

• Tracking of your job applications and application status

 

Step 1: Sign up

• Click on the ‘Sign Up’ button.

• Fill in your First Name, Last Name, Email and Password. Click on ‘Sign up’.

 

Step 2: Validate email

Congrats you just signed up for DDH Careers account. The system will automatically send a validation notice to your email address. This step is necessary to confirm that the email address is correct so that all emails from DDH Talent Management Team will reach you.

To validate your email address:

• Look for an email from Notification DDH.

• Click on the link provided in the email.

• A link Registration confirmation will be forwarded to your email. Upon verification of your account, click Log in to continue.

 

Step 3: Create your Profile

This will let you build your profile in an organized template so that you will not miss out on any information needed by DDH Talent Management Team.

To create your Profile for the first time:

• Login to your DDH Careers account.

• Click on ‘My Profile’ from the drop-down menu

• Fill in your basic information Click on ‘Save’.

• Fill in your highest qualification and latest work experience to start creating your Profile.

• Please ensure that you fill up all the necessary fields until 100% complete.

• You may also upload your resume, diploma, TOR and other credentials in pdf and save as one file.

 

Step 4: Search for a job and Apply

When you apply via DDH Careers, both your Profile and the uploaded resume (if available) will be sent to us immediately. The Talent Management Team will contact you directly if you are shortlisted for an interview. Before you apply, ensure that your Profile is complete and ready for job application.

To apply:

• Ensure that you are logged on to your DDH Careers account.

• Search for relevant jobs. Ensure that the pop-up blocker of your browser is turned off.

• Click on the ‘Apply Now’ button located at the bottom of the job advertisement to submit your application.

• Your Profile and the uploaded resume (if available) will be sent to DDH Talent Management Team for processing.

 

Step 5: Checking of Application Status

To check your application status:

• Login to your DDH Careers account.

• Go to ‘My Profile’ and select ‘Online Applications’ from the drop-down menu.

• The application status can be found in each application box. You may check the definition of the application status by clicking on the status.

 

What does each status mean?

 

• Profile viewed X time(s) by Talent Management Team: The Talent Management Team has viewed your Profile.

• Scheduled for Interview: The employer has scheduled you for an interview. View the scheduled interview at My Profile > Interview Invitations.

• Not Suitable: Your application is not suitable for this job.